After opening a bottle of wine, does the cork get tossed onto the counter or stored away in a draw?  Many people save their corks to recycle, for arts and crafts, to remember wine, and even because they like the way they look.  Store your corks in style with newest trend in wine home décor, cork cages. Cork cages make for a simple yet elegant home décor item and helps keep wine corks organized. The cork cages are available in six styles: Handbag, Wine Bottle, Wine Barrel, Globe, House, and Pineapple.

The line began with the [Wine Bottle cork cage] and Wine Barrel cork cage.  Each cage is crafted from metal and has detailing to make it a pleasure to look at.   These cages are a great addition to the wine themed kitchen.  For the wine loving women, a third cork cage was added, the Handbag cork cage.   Complete with handles like that of a purse, the handbag cork cage will make a great gift to any woman who never seem to have enough purses.  With the cork cage doing well in the market place, they decided to extend the line to handbags and few months late, incorporated the globe, house and pineapple into the line.

Celebrate the diverse regions that create our tasty treat by storing the corks in the Corks of the World cork cage.  This wine cork cage resembles a traditional globe, complete with an arrow as the axis.Since the globe spins on the axis, you can have a little fun and spin it decide between Merlot or Shiraz.Use this cork cage to celebrate all of the parts of the world where great wine comes from.

Use the [House of Corks ] to give your wine corks a true place to call home.Leave the house cork cage out in the kitchen to drop the corks down the chimney as you open bottles of wine.Several details can be found on the house, such as stylized windows and doorway.   The tall yet thin design allows you to display the House of Corks cork cage in a tight space
